#6f2668 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6f2668 is composed of 43.5% red, 14.9%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.8% magenta, 6.3%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 305.8 degrees, a saturation of 49% and a lightness of 29.2%. #6f2668 color hex could be obtained by blending #de4cd0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#6f2668 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6f2668 has RGB values of R:111, G:38,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.06,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7284328.

Shades and Tints of #6f2668
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090308 is the darkest color, while #fdf9fd is the lightest one.
